What are Humic Acids?
Humic acids are the end product of the
microbial degradation and petrification of plant and animal debris
and are one of the most important constituents of fertile soils.
Humic acid derivatives are mixtures of humic acid, and fulvic
acid. Humic acids are mined for agricultural use from both land
and sea. The end product contains a majority of organic material
(concentrated humic acid) mixed with smaller amounts of mineral
matter.

One accepted use for humic acid is in pre-plant or starter
phosphorus bands, as it greatly improves phosphate availability
even in high lime soils. Plants have a hard time taking up
phosphates in high pH soils and the abundance of calcium in these
soils leads to the formation of calcium phosphates that become
almost as insoluble as teeth. Phosphorus tie-up is especially
critical for annual crops that are planted in the Spring when
soils are cool. Humic acid chelates soluble calcium and protects
the phosphates from the calcium / phosphate interaction. The amine
functional groups of humic acid can then absorb the phosphate
anions, improving availability for plant uptake.
